Mine had snapped when I bought the car, I welded it just using my hobby mig welder. Two years later it was still secure but ended up buying a stainless system. If you were near me I’d weld it for you for say £20/£40. That price they quoted seems a bit harsh.
 
Seems a bit expensive. I got some welding done on my M exhaust boxes in past couple of years and including new Hangers sourced from internet,the whole lot was only around £150
The 4 new stainless steel hangers were around £90, so labour for welding etc was £60.
